Waterfiends are the elemental cousins of the Pyrefiend and the Icefiend, and may be assigned as a slayer task by Duradel/Lapalok, Kuradal, and Morvran. They are found in the Ancient Cavern which can be accessed by completing Barbarian Training to the pyre ship stage. Waterfiends are also found in the Chaos Tunnels and the eastern coast of the Wilderness. Waterfiends with slightly different drops can be found in the Ghorrock Fortress.

Waterfiends have a very high charm drop rate, especially for crimson charms (around 80%). For this reason, they are targeted by many players who wish to level up summoning quickly, making them more popular than other crimson charm droppers (demons, dust devils, etc.). At Ghorrock they drop 2 charms at a time but have a halved drop rate, making the charms per hour effectively the same.

They are weakest against crossbow bolts, making any form of ranged a good choice for killing them. They can also be killed with higher level magic weapons. Using darklight is a viable method for those wishing to use melee. The waterfiends at Ghorrock seem to be easier to hit, but also seem to deal more damage. At Ghorrock they are found on the lower floor after completing The Temple at Senntisten and are aggressive.

If the player is killing waterfiends for a Slayer assignment then they can gain 20% additional Slayer experience by equipping a demonic skull while killing waterfiends in the Wilderness. They can gain another 20% extra experience per kill while killing waterfiends in the Wilderness if they accept a special slayer contract from Erskine while assigned waterfiends as a Slayer task. These experience bonuses stack, meaning the player may gain 40% extra Slayer experience. Completing a special slayer contract rewards the player with a choice of coins or combat experience.

Trivia[]

  • Waterfiends had an unannounced graphical update on 5 June 2008 - with this, some of their drops changed. Then, later that day, a system update after Smoking Kills was released to remove the drop change, only to be changed once again to fix some bugs and change some of the drops that were mentioned on the forums.
  • Waterfiends gained a massive buff with the update of 17 June 2013.
